Transaction 2e30680257c99786d481cf4662cd18647b41fe7b3b50737e33b70122cae4632e

2 Input
2 Outputs
  • 2e30680257c99786d481cf4662cd18647b41fe7b3b50737e33b70122cae4632e:0
  • value  5660339
    address  16WPNczmeRzo9gmux2XTWYWHHVMFNgxaDi
  • 2e30680257c99786d481cf4662cd18647b41fe7b3b50737e33b70122cae4632e:1
  • value  20307317
    address  17j227zLJVprHZHFeTnWM7CKF376bVeStK